i am a graduate of la trobe university and some of my classmates there do not have any working experience in our country. they were just fresh grads who want to try their luck here in AU. so i think that already answered your question. AHPRA, nor some of bridging schools here in AU do not require a working experience to approve the applications. as you have said, it will just be difficult to find an employer if you do not have any working experience once you finish the course. i hope this helps. cheers!
